Could Victoria’s compliance collapse threaten our holiday season? – The Age
The coronavirus cluster in NSW is a reminder for Victoria to not forget about contactless check-in at venues.

Unfortunately, an alarming number of businesses in malls, shopping centres and outlets in Victoria are ignoring the need to safeguard their patrons, are not signing in visitors and are not conducting contactless tracing.
The Victorian government has not released scan-in data on its QR code and app, and the question remains, why?
